Eclipse magnetic filtration device shortlisted
Claimed to be particularly effective with machine tool oils and coolants, a high-intensity magnetic filter by Eclipse Magnetics significantly improves filtration efficiency over conventional systems.
The Eclipse Magnetics Micromag magnetic filter has been shortlisted by Centaur Publication's 'Metalworking Production' magazine for a 2008 MWP Award in the Best Quality Control Equipment or System category.
Micromag secured a place on the shortlist because it offers an innovative flow-geometry path, which ensures the filter cannot block and which prevents excessive pressure loss, both of which are crucial to efficient operation.
This is achieved by arranging the magnets around a central magnetic flux return shield to ensure that all the magnets' performance is used whilst still allowing unaffected fluid flow, even when the core is fully saturated with contamination.
Launched by Eclipse Magnetics in 2007, Micromag is a high-intensity magnetic filter which significantly improves filtration efficiency over conventional systems.
It uses high-power neodymium 'rare earth' magnets to remove ferrous and para-magnetic contamination from fluids.
Eclipse told manufacturingtalk that the system is particularly effective with machine tool oils and coolants.
For many customers, installing Micromag has been an essential part of achieving its environmental commitments, said Eclipse.
All that remains in Micromag is the metallic contamination, which can be quickly and easily removed, avoiding the need to dispose of dirty cartridges.
With minimal running costs and no requirement for consumables, Micromag is becoming an essential part of many of the world's leading manufacturing operations.
Micromag is available in three housing sizes: 5in and 10in, with 1in inlet/outlet ports, and a 20in unit, with 1in ports.
All units are supplied with port adaptors to suit most pipe connection sizes.
Although compact in size, Micromag has a large holding capacity with units able to hold 900, 1800 and 3600g of contamination, resulting in less downtime.
